King’s College London is seeking a part-time International Advice Support Officer (21 hours/week) to assist international students with immigration queries and transitions.
The role focuses on first contact advice, guidance, and referrals, helping students navigate UK regulations and the university environment.
You will join the Visa & International Student Advice Team and contribute to delivering high-quality information and support.
